BAT, early 1.000 lb. glide bomb in pilotless small aircraft launched from USN PBY CATALINA or PB4Y-2 PRIVATEER aircraft, successful use against Japanese ships-WWII. Outmoded by Atomic Bomb. Termed "glombs", propulsion was by inertia and gravity.
